PM Oli calls Cabinet meeting at 6 pm

Cabinet expansion likely



KATHMANDU: Prime Minister KP Oli has called a meeting of the Cabinet at 6 pm on Friday, Baluwatar sources said.

Friday’s meeting is the first Cabinet meeting after the dissolution of the House of Representatives (HoR).

Meanwhile, seven ministers have already resigned protesting the dissolution of the HoR.

Earlier on Sunday, an emergency meeting of the Cabinet had recommended to dissolution of the HoR to President Bidya Devi Bhandari.

Meanwhile, Prime Minister Oli is likely to reshuffle his Cabinet on Friday evening, according to sources.

Prime Minister Oli is likely to appoint new ministers in the eight ministries.

There are currently 18 ministers and ministers of state in the 25-member cabinet after seven ministers resigned.

Ministers, including Ghanshyam Bhusal, Giriraj Mani Pokhrel, Yogesh Bhattarai, Barshaman Pun, Shakti Basnet, Rameshwar Rai Yadav and Bina Magar had resigned protesting the PM’s move to dissolve the HoR.
